Register for your free account! | Forgot your password?

Go Back   elitepvpers > MMORPGs > Flyff > Flyff Private Server
You last visited: Today at 13:07

  • Please register to post and access all features, it's quick, easy and FREE!

Advertisement



[Sourcen Frage] NewScrolls

Discussion on [Sourcen Frage] NewScrolls within the Flyff Private Server forum part of the Flyff category.

Closed Thread
 
Old   #1

 
™Dryad's Avatar
 
elite*gold: 380
Join Date: Oct 2008
Posts: 2,262
Received Thanks: 382
[Sourcen Frage] NewScrolls

Huhu Community..

Ich habe grade neue Scroll´s in den Sourcen geaddet....

Und bei der World Exe bekomm ich diese Error´s

Quote:
d:\Files\Source\Program\WORLDSERVER\DPSrvr.cpp(583 5): error C2046: illegal case
d:\Files\Source\Program\WORLDSERVER\DPSrvr.cpp(583 8): error C2043: illegal break
Eintrag von den Scroll´s

PHP Code:
#ifdef __NEWSCROLLS
            
case II_SYS_SYS_SCR_ELEMUPGRADE://setzt element auf +20
                
{
                
b    DoUseItemTarget_ElemMaxpUserpMaterialpTarget);
                break;
                }
            case 
II_SYS_SYS_SCR_UPGRADESOCKEL://schaltet alle sockel frei
                
{
                
b    DoUseItemTarget_SockelMaxpUserpMaterialpTarget );
                break;
                }
            case 
II_SYS_SYS_SCR_UPGRADE10://setzt auf +10
                
{
                
b    DoUseItemTarget_ExtMaxpUserpMaterialpTarget );
                break;
                }
            case 
II_SYS_SYS_SCR_UNBINDSCROLL://entfernt seelenbindung
                
{
                    if( !
pTarget || !pTarget->IsFlagCItemElem::binds ) )
                    {
                        
pUser->AddText("Das Item hat keine Seelenbindung");
                        
FALSE;
                    }
                    else
                    {
                            
pTarget->ResetFlagCItemElem::binds );
                            
pUser->UpdateItem( (BYTE)( pTarget->m_dwObjId ), UI_FLAGMAKELONGpTarget->m_dwObjIndexpTarget->m_byFlag ) );

                            
b    TRUE;
                    }
                    break;
                }
#endif //__NEWSCROLLS 
Würde mich freuen wenn mir da einer weiter helfen könnte..

lg
™Dryad is offline  
Old 01/20/2013, 14:26   #2
ベトナム警察




 
Lumi's Avatar
 
elite*gold: 0
The Black Market: 517/0/0
Join Date: Jan 2012
Posts: 16,499
Received Thanks: 3,527
Sag mal, wie viele Themen möchtest du noch eröffnen?
Es wäre durchaus übersichtlicher, wenn du ein Thread für alle Fragen und Probleme eröffnest.
Lumi is offline  
Thanks
1 User
Old 01/20/2013, 14:50   #3
 
ThoughtfulDev's Avatar
 
elite*gold: 28
Join Date: Aug 2012
Posts: 2,335
Received Thanks: 471
in der defineitem.h der source müssen die items auch rein
z.b II_SYS_SYS_SCR_ELEMUPGRADE
ThoughtfulDev is offline  
Old 01/20/2013, 15:03   #4
 
Allowedes's Avatar
 
elite*gold: 0
Join Date: Dec 2012
Posts: 85
Received Thanks: 26
@Shonenx33 Damit hat es gar nichts zu tun, den Fehler erkennt ein Blinder mit Krückstock.

@TE
Auf die Planke mit dir ! Schäm dich du kannst keine case oder break Anweisungen benutzen wenn du keine switch Anweisung hast....

Code:
// C2046.cpp
int main() {
   int i = 0;

   case 0:       // C2046, delete case to resolve

   switch(i) {
      case 0:    // ok
      break;

      case 1:    // ok
      break;

      default:   // ok
      break;
   }
}
Ein Beispiel wie es richtig ist und wie nicht..
Allowedes is offline  
Thanks
1 User
Old 01/20/2013, 15:12   #5
 
dennisdra's Avatar
 
elite*gold: 23
Join Date: Jun 2008
Posts: 949
Received Thanks: 376
Zu dumm zum leechen xDDDDDDDD
In was für einer traurigen Welt leben wir eigentlich?!

Ich würds an deiner Stelle lassen, will garnicht wissen wie du failst wenn du anfängst das Tabbed Inventory aus Krustenkäse's Source zu leechen xDD

Aber um doch was nützliches beizutragen!

Fehler lesen, erkennen und nachdenken ist doch nicht schwer...
Nur weil da das define steht heißt es nicht das alles davor unwichtig ist und weggelassen werden kann.

Denn das hier fehlt:

Code:
		[COLOR="Red"][B]switch( pMaterial->m_dwItemId ) 
		{[/B][/COLOR]
#ifdef __NEWSCROLLS
			case II_SYS_SYS_SCR_ELEMUPGRADE://setzt element auf +20
				{
				b	= DoUseItemTarget_ElemMax( pUser, pMaterial, pTarget);
				break;
				}
			case II_SYS_SYS_SCR_UPGRADESOCKEL://schaltet alle sockel frei
				{
				b	= DoUseItemTarget_SockelMax( pUser, pMaterial, pTarget );
				break;
				}
			case II_SYS_SYS_SCR_UPGRADE10://setzt auf +10
				{
				b	= DoUseItemTarget_ExtMax( pUser, pMaterial, pTarget );
				break;
				}
			case II_SYS_SYS_SCR_UNBINDSCROLL://entfernt seelenbindung
				{
					if( !pTarget || !pTarget->IsFlag( CItemElem::binds ) )
					{
						pUser->AddText("Das Item hat keine Seelenbindung");
						b = FALSE;
					}
					else
					{
							pTarget->ResetFlag( CItemElem::binds );
							pUser->UpdateItem( (BYTE)( pTarget->m_dwObjId ), UI_FLAG, MAKELONG( pTarget->m_dwObjIndex, pTarget->m_byFlag ) );

							b	= TRUE;
					}
					break;
				}
#endif
@
Quote:
Originally Posted by Lumi' View Post
Sag mal, wie viele Themen möchtest du noch eröffnen?
Es wäre durchaus übersichtlicher, wenn du ein Thread für alle Fragen und Probleme eröffnest.
Vielleicht sollte jemand direkt nen Tutorial für den Source machen, in dem es darum geht wie man die Systeme rausleecht...
dennisdra is offline  
Old 01/20/2013, 15:29   #6

 
™Dryad's Avatar
 
elite*gold: 380
Join Date: Oct 2008
Posts: 2,262
Received Thanks: 382
Quote:
Originally Posted by dennisdra View Post
Zu dumm zum leechen xDDDDDDDD
In was für einer traurigen Welt leben wir eigentlich?!

Ich würds an deiner Stelle lassen, will garnicht wissen wie du failst wenn du anfängst das Tabbed Inventory aus Krustenkäse's Source zu leechen xDD

Aber um doch was nützliches beizutragen!

Fehler lesen, erkennen und nachdenken ist doch nicht schwer...
Nur weil da das define steht heißt es nicht das alles davor unwichtig ist und weggelassen werden kann.

Denn das hier fehlt:

Code:
		[COLOR="Red"][B]switch( pMaterial->m_dwItemId ) 
		{[/B][/COLOR]
#ifdef __NEWSCROLLS
			case II_SYS_SYS_SCR_ELEMUPGRADE://setzt element auf +20
				{
				b	= DoUseItemTarget_ElemMax( pUser, pMaterial, pTarget);
				break;
				}
			case II_SYS_SYS_SCR_UPGRADESOCKEL://schaltet alle sockel frei
				{
				b	= DoUseItemTarget_SockelMax( pUser, pMaterial, pTarget );
				break;
				}
			case II_SYS_SYS_SCR_UPGRADE10://setzt auf +10
				{
				b	= DoUseItemTarget_ExtMax( pUser, pMaterial, pTarget );
				break;
				}
			case II_SYS_SYS_SCR_UNBINDSCROLL://entfernt seelenbindung
				{
					if( !pTarget || !pTarget->IsFlag( CItemElem::binds ) )
					{
						pUser->AddText("Das Item hat keine Seelenbindung");
						b = FALSE;
					}
					else
					{
							pTarget->ResetFlag( CItemElem::binds );
							pUser->UpdateItem( (BYTE)( pTarget->m_dwObjId ), UI_FLAG, MAKELONG( pTarget->m_dwObjIndex, pTarget->m_byFlag ) );

							b	= TRUE;
					}
					break;
				}
#endif
@


Vielleicht sollte jemand direkt nen Tutorial für den Source machen, in dem es darum geht wie man die Systeme rausleecht...
Miep Miep...
Also ich kann von mir behaupten das ich net dumm bin...
Nur weil ich net wusste wie ich das fixxe heiß es ja net gleich das
ich dumm bin....

Aber habs hinbekommen,ohne deine hilfe........

#closerequest

Ps:Lumi ich weiß garnet was du hast, ich öffne eigl selten Tread´s.
Nur weil ich jetze mal 3 stück oder so geöffnet hab geht doch net die Welt unter..

Es gibs User die machen weit aus mehr Treads am tag auf weil sie probleme haben..

lg
™Dryad is offline  
Old 01/20/2013, 15:42   #7
ベトナム警察




 
Lumi's Avatar
 
elite*gold: 0
The Black Market: 517/0/0
Join Date: Jan 2012
Posts: 16,499
Received Thanks: 3,527


Mein Problem steht bereits oben.
Bedenke dies in Zukunft.
Lumi is offline  
Closed Thread


Similar Threads Similar Threads
[Sourcen]Frage obj datei
01/14/2012 - Flyff Private Server - 2 Replies
Hallo Com.. Ich möchte den Guard von Yoshi einbaun... Hab aber grad gesehn das man 2 obj datein einfügen, leider weiß ich net so.. Weil wenn man auf Add->Add Existing_Item werden die obj net angezeigt.. Würde mich freuen wenn mir einer sagen könnte wohin die genau müssten.. lg
[Sourcen]Frage
01/03/2012 - Flyff Private Server - 4 Replies
huhu Com.. Ich bin leider kein Pro. der sich wirklich mit den Sourcen auskennt, also bitte ich euch um hilfe... Sofern ich die neuz immer compli bekomm ich dieses error´s E:\BF Source\Source\_Interface\WndManager.cpp(7503): fatal error C1003: error count exceeds 100; stopping compilation E:\BF Source\Source\_Interface\WndManager.cpp(1010): error C2601: 'CWndMgr::DestroyApplet' : local function definitions are illegal E:\BF Source\Source\_Interface\WndManager.cpp(1035): error C2601:...
VK YouTube Bot Sourcen!
06/21/2011 - elite*gold Trading - 5 Replies
Huhu Überschrift sagt alles ^ Mit den Sourcen kann man abonnieren /liken/Disliken/Kommentieren Sofortkauf 10€ verkaufe die sourcen 3mal nehme auch e*G , 430e*G
(S) YT Bot/Erstell Sourcen (B) PSC
06/19/2011 - elite*gold Trading - 5 Replies
Überschrift sagt alles meldet euch via pn mit eurer skype addy..
Wer hat D2NT Manager Sourcen?
08/30/2009 - Diablo 2 - 1 Replies
Hallo Forum, weiß jemand wie man an den Sourcen des D2NT-Manager's rankommt? Heissen Dank, frank



All times are GMT +2. The time now is 13:07.


Powered by vBulletin®
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.

Support | Contact Us | FAQ | Advertising | Privacy Policy | Terms of Service | Abuse
Copyright ©2026 elitepvpers All Rights Reserved.